Abstract

Ayurveda can safely be applied to heal many difficult conditions [1]. Sheeta Pitta can be correlated to Urticaria / Hives in the Western medical parlance. This disease is of Vata Dosha origin, with a mixed picture of Vata, Pitta, and Kapha symptoms. Two cases; males 16 years and 19 years having recurrent urticaria for 7 years and 3 years, respectively were considered for the present study. Both received Shodhana treatment with Virechana procedure, followed by Shamana (palliative management) and showed significant improvements.
